用于内容中心网络中自适应转发策略的方法和装置的制造方法

文档序号:8288275阅读:305来源:国知局
用于内容中心网络中自适应转发策略的方法和装置的制造方法
【专利说明】用于内容中心网络中自适应转发策略的方法和装置 相关申请案的交叉参考
[0001] 本发明要求2012年11月9日由钱海洋(HaiyangQian)等人递交的发明名 称为"用于内容中心网络中自适应转发策略的方法和装置(MethodandApparatusfor AdaptiveForwardingStrategiesinContent-CentricNetworking) "的第 13/672924 号 美国临时专利申请案的在先申请优先权,该临时专利申请案要求2012年2月21日由钱海 洋(HaiyangQian)等人递交的发明名称为"用于内容中心网络中自适应转发策略的方法和 装置(MethodandApparatusforAdaptiveForwardingStrategiesinContent-Centric Networking) "的第61/601321号美国临时专利申请案的在先申请优先权,该临时专利申请 案的内容以引用的方式全文并入本文本中。 关于由联邦政府赞助的 研宄或开发的声明
[0002] 不适用。 参考缩微胶片附录
[0003] 不适用。
【背景技术】
[0004] 内容导向网络(CON)、内容中心网络(CCN)和信息中心网络(ICN)可统称为命名数 据网络(NDN)。这些网络中的内容路由器负责将用户请求及内容路由至合适的接收方。在 NDN中,作为内容分发框架的一部分的每个实体都分配有在域范围内唯一的名称。这些实体 可以包括视频片段或网页等数据内容和/或路由器、交换机或服务器等基础设施元件。内 容路由器会使用名称前缀在内容网络中对内容报文进行路由,这些名称前缀可以是完整的 内容名称或合适的内容名称前缀,而不是网络地址。在NDN中,包括发布、请求、以及管理 (例如,签名、验证、修改、删除等)的内容分发可以基于内容名称而非内容位置来进行。NDN 不同于传统互联网协议(IP)网络的一个方面在于,NDN能够将多个地理点互连,并临时缓 存内容或更为持久地存储内容。这可以实现从网络而非初始服务器提供内容,因此可以显 著改进用户体验。缓存/存储可以用于由用户提取的实时数据,或用于属于用户或第三方 供应商等内容供应商的持久数据。
[0005] 思科可视网络索引(CiscoVisualNetworkingIndex)的一项预测表明在2015 年互联网每5分钟将分发7. 3拍字节的电影。然而,互联网是基于主机对主机模型设计的, 不适用于需要支持一对多以及多对多传送的内容分发。另外,IP网络对功能移动性以及安 全性的支持是有限的。当设备移动并进行切换时,传输控制协议(TCP)会话常常超时。由 于IP地址的改变或由于网络拥堵等问题,业务发生中断。此外,思科的预测表明无线设备 访问互联网产生的流量在2015年将超过有线设备的流量。
[0006] 应当注意的是,在本发明中术语CON、CCN、ICN和NDN可互换使用,这是因为本发明 公开的方法、系统和装置可彼此适用和合并。

【发明内容】

[0007] 在一项实施例中,本发明包括一个命名数据网络(NDN)节点,该节点由多个端口 组成,每个端口都与内容中心网络中的一个不同节点耦合,本发明还包括一个耦合在端口 上的处理器,其中所述处理器用于探测每个所述端口针对兴趣的性能,所述兴趣与所述端 口中的多个端口有关,其中所述端口标识出下一跳,其中与所述兴趣有关的多个端口中的 一个被用于在NDN节点接收到所述兴趣时转发该兴趣,并且基于选择几率来确定所使用的 端口,所述选择机率确定于所述端口性能探测的反馈。
[0008] 在另一项实施例中,本发明包括一种网络节点中用于转发内容中心网络数据的方 法,该方法包括将兴趣与网络节点中的多个端口进行关联,使用处理器探测每个端口与所 述兴趣对应的探测兴趣,从而确定每个端口的性能表现,以及在端口探测反馈的基础上,更 新对于转发信息库(FIB)兴趣的选择机率项。
[0009] 在另一项实施例中,本发明包括一个网络节点,包括:多个端口,其中每个端口都 提供一条通往对应节点的通信路径;一个控制平面路由层级,其中多个端口与对应于某个 兴趣的内容名称前缀关联(在最长匹配方面);一个探测引擎,用于探测对于每个端口的兴 趣;以及包含策略信息的转发层,所述策略信息用于确定使用所述多个端口中的哪一个端 口来转发对应于所述前缀的引入兴趣,其中所述策略信息根据探测结果而确定。
[0010] 从结合附图和所附权利要求书进行的以下【具体实施方式】将更清楚地理解这些和 其他特征。
【附图说明】
[0011] 为了更全面地理解本发明,现在参考以下结合附图和【具体实施方式】进行的简要描 述,其中相同参考标号表不相同部分。
[0012] 图1为根据一项公开实施例所述的示例性网络节点的方框图,描述节点的转发平 面(包括转发层和策略层)中的功能模块。
[0013] 图2为一项实施例的示意图,描述常规兴趣和探测兴趣如何在NDN层以独立模式 处理。
[0014] 图3为一项实施例的示意图,描述传播探测/常规兴趣并使用广播选项以独立模 式发送探测/常规数据的一个示例。
[0015] 图4为一项实施例的示意图,描述传播探测/常规兴趣并以独立模式发送探测/ 常规数据的一个示例。
[0016] 图5为一项实施例的示意图,描述在兴趣传播和数据返回期间记录时间戳的示例 性方式。
[0017] 图6为一项实施例的示意图,描述在兴趣传播和数据返回期间记录时间戳和平均 队列时延的示例性方式。
[0018] 图7为一项实施例的示意图,描述FIB中的前缀聚集。
[0019] 图8为一项实施例所述的无线网络的示意图,在该无线网络中可实施所述自适应 转发策略。
[0020] 图9示出了网络节点的一项实施例,该网络节点可以是经由网络传输和处理数据 的任意设备。
[0021] 图10示出了典型的通用网络节点,该网络节点适用于实施一个或多个本文本所 公开的组件的实施例。
【具体实施方式】
[0022] 最初应理解,尽管下文提供一个或多个实施例的说明性实施方案,但可使用任意 数目的当前已知或现有的技术来实施所公开的系统和/或方法。本发明决不应限于下文所 说明的描述性实施方案、图式和技术,包含本文所说明描述的示范性设计和实施方案,而是 可以在所附权利要求书的范围以及其均等物的完整范围内修改。
[0023] NDN通过路由标识内容对象的名称以及将内容对象与内容对象的位置去关联来处 理信息传播问题。NDN路由器可具有待定兴趣表(PIT)、转发信息库(FIB)和内容存储器 (CS)。开启NDN的设备可通过将包含内容名称的兴趣报文多播至网络中来查找最接近的内 容副本。内容可位于生产者端的任意主机中或者缓存于NDN路由器的CS中。该特征使用 户能够检索相同的内容而无需在网络中产生重复的流量。只要有一些用户检索过该内容, 该内容可缓存在网络中并可由任意数量的用户提取。
[0024] 鉴于相当大一部分的内容就流行度而言在本质上是动态的且不可预测的,NDN的 一个技术难题便是网络中的内容放置和传播。例如,当用户请求检索命名内容时,该用户不 知道谁预先请求过该相同的内容。此外,对于内容位置未知和动态流量的情况(例如车辆 到车辆网络等临时(ad-hoc)无线网络),由于移动性变更和参差的空中链路质量,这种情 况会引入某些动态。NDN网络中不可预测的动态使得内容路由器很难确定转发请求所需内 容的"兴趣"的最佳方向。该难题引发"策略层"的设计,该设计实施了机率智能函数和算 法以帮助内容路由器确定NDN中内容检索和数据转发的最佳/次佳路线。
[0025] 在NDN中转发的无环数据,可以针对FIB中的某个前缀,灵活选择端口列表中的接 口(端口),而这也是NDN的内在优点。本文中的术语,"接口"、"端口"、以及"端"可互换使 用。关于如何使用该特征,可参
当前第1页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1